login  Naam:   Wachtwoord: 
Registreer je!
 Forum

[GD Libary]Cannot modify header information - headers already sent (Opgelost)

Offline dmbekker - 14/08/2010 10:52 (laatste wijziging 14/08/2010 10:56)
Avatar van dmbekkerLid Hallo,

Ik heb hier bij de Tut's gelezen over GD Library en het geprobeerd. Maar hij geeft nu de foutmelding.

Citaat:
Warning: Cannot modify header information - headers already sent by (output started at C:xampphtdocsindex.php:1) in C:xampphtdocsindex.php on line 2


Daaronder staat allemaal rare tekentjes.

Citaat:
�PNG  ��� IHDR��,�������^�'����PLTE���� 7���IDATX��� ��� �Om7������������V������IEND�B`�

EDIT
:S hij weergeeft de code nu nog raarder... Ik maak even een printscreen.
Hier is de afbeelding http://img72.imageshack.us/img72/1615/phperror.png

En dit is mijn code die ik gebruik.

Plaatscode: 139816

Wat doe ik fout? 

3 antwoorden

Gesponsorde links
Offline Stijn - 14/08/2010 10:59
Avatar van Stijn PHP expert Niets maar je editor kan onzichtbare tekens toevoegen aan je script en dan krijg je van die griezelige errors. Je kan dit fixen door het eens in kladblok te schrijven en op te slaan of met een hex-editor de eerste bytes verwijderen.
Bedankt door: dmbekker
Offline Filip - 14/08/2010 11:01
Avatar van Filip IRC guru Je gebruikt die code waarschijnlijk rechtstreeks in je php, en niet als image of iets dergelijks. Daardoor kan de header niet meer aangepast worden omdat er al output geweest is.

Indien je de code apart gebruikt zal het waarschijnlijk liegen aan het feit dat er een lege lijn staan VOOR je <?php wat gelijk staat aan output..
Offline dmbekker - 14/08/2010 11:27 (laatste wijziging 14/08/2010 12:02)
Avatar van dmbekker Lid
Stijn schreef:
Niets maar je editor kan onzichtbare tekens toevoegen aan je script en dan krijg je van die griezelige errors. Je kan dit fixen door het eens in kladblok te schrijven en op te slaan of met een hex-editor de eerste bytes verwijderen.


Hellup wat is een hex-editor  

Dat van kladblok ga ik even proberen

nephilim schreef:
Je gebruikt die code waarschijnlijk rechtstreeks in je php, en niet als image of iets dergelijks. Daardoor kan de header niet meer aangepast worden omdat er al output geweest is.

Indien je de code apart gebruikt zal het waarschijnlijk liegen aan het feit dat er een lege lijn staan VOOR je <?php wat gelijk staat aan output..


En daar snap ik ook al geen ene reet van 

Dat stukje code wat ik gaf is trouwens de enige code die op de pagina staat (om te testen er komt nog meer bij)

Met kladblok ik het me nu gelukt

Maar nu is de afbeelding alleen een rode rechthoek de tekst is niet zichtbaar.
De code is nog hetzelfde

Het is al opgelost ik heb het uiteindelijk zo gedaan Plaatscode: 139817
Gesponsorde links
Dit onderwerp is gesloten.
Actieve forumberichten
© 2002-2024 Sitemasters.be - Regels - Laadtijd: 0.179s